Introduction
Graffiti can be an unwelcome sight, detracting from your property's appearance and potentially lowering its value. For homeowners in Loganville, GA, the cost of professional graffiti removal typically ranges between $300 and $1,000 per job. This range covers most common scenarios you might encounter when dealing with unwanted tags or murals on your property.
While the typical cost falls within this range, the full envelope for graffiti removal services can extend from $300 to $1,600 per job, particularly for more extensive or challenging projects. The final price depends on various factors, including the size and complexity of the graffiti, the type of surface affected, and the specific methods and products required for safe and effective removal.

Labor Costs
| Service Aspect | Estimated Cost/Factor |
|---|---|
| Per square foot | $1 to $3 per square foot, potentially up to $3.50 per square foot |
| Minimum service charge | Some professionals have a minimum of $500 for graffiti removal jobs |
| Complexity of graffiti | Larger or more intricate designs will incur higher labor costs |
| Surface material | Sensitive surfaces (e.g., bare brick) require specialized techniques, increasing labor costs |
| Access difficulty | Hard-to-reach areas may require additional equipment and labor time |
Key Cost Factors
- Size and Scope of Graffiti: Larger areas of graffiti or multiple tags will naturally cost more to remove. A small, easily accessible tag will be significantly less expensive than a large mural or widespread vandalism.
- Type of Surface Material: Different surfaces react differently to cleaning agents. Porous materials like bare brick can absorb paint, making removal more challenging and requiring specialized, gentle, but effective methods, which can increase costs. Concrete, metal, and painted surfaces each require specific approaches.
- Type of Paint/Ink Used: The composition of the graffiti — whether it's spray paint, marker, or another type of ink — influences the choice of cleaning products and removal techniques, impacting the overall cost.
- Accessibility of the Area: Graffiti located in hard-to-reach places, such as high walls or confined spaces, may require ladders, scaffolding, or specialized equipment, leading to higher labor costs.
- Urgency of Removal: While not explicitly a cost factor, prompt removal can prevent deeper penetration of the graffiti into the surface, potentially saving on effort and cost in the long run.

Tips for Hiring
- Get Multiple Quotes: Contact several local professional pressure washers or graffiti removal services in Loganville, GA, to compare pricing and services. This helps ensure you're getting a fair estimate for your specific situation.
- Inquire About Methods: Ask prospective contractors about the specific cleaning products and techniques they plan to use. Ensure they use methods appropriate for your surface type to prevent damage.
- Check for Insurance and Licensing: Verify that the company you hire is licensed and insured. This protects you in case of any accidents or property damage during the graffiti removal process.
- Ask for Guarantees: Some companies offer guarantees on their work. While complete stain removal isn't always possible, a reputable company will stand by the quality of their services and address any concerns.
